Mega Greek Myth Raps by Tony Mitton

These old Greek myths read new and rappy. Check the flava, cool and zappy! Modern re-tellings - in popular rap rhyme of two well-known stories from Greek mythology. The downfall of Icarus, the boy who refuses to heed his father's warnings and flies too close to the sun. And King Midas, who gets into trouble when his greedy dreams about gold come true...
Tony Mitton is a children's poet of increasing popularity. Recent publications include the successful Dazzling Digger series (Kingfisher) illustrated by Ant Parker and his debut poetry collection, Plam (Scholastic). The Rap Rhymes books have all been runaway bestsellers. Royal Raps won the Nottinghamshire Children's Book Award and Fangtastic Raps won the Nottingham City Council Libraries' Experian Big 3 Book Award. Tony lives in Cambridge. Martin Chatterton is a hugely popular illustrator, well known for his children's books as well as for advertisements. His bold, cartoon-like illustrations appeal particularly strongly to boys. His most popular books include The Utterly Nutty Football Book (Puffin) and the Rap Rhymes series for Orchard.
